The Good
- Convenience: Play anytime and anywhere with mobile apps designed for on-the-go gaming.
- Variety of Games: Online casinos often offer multiple bingo variants, including 90-ball, 75-ball, and themed games.
- Promotions: Many platforms provide lucrative bonuses and promotions, such as a welcome bonus of up to 100% on your first deposit.
- Social Interaction: Most online bingo games include chat features, allowing players to engage with others, creating a community feel.
The Bad
- App Performance: Some apps may lag or crash, especially on older devices. An ideal app should have a loading time of under 3 seconds.
- Wagering Requirements: Bonuses often come with high wagering requirements, such as 35x, which can be challenging to fulfil.
- User Interface: A cluttered interface can make navigation difficult. Ideally, important buttons should be within thumb reach and easily accessible.
The Ugly
- Touch Interface Issues: Small buttons and poor layout can lead to accidental clicks, significantly affecting gameplay.
- Limited Payment Options: Some casinos offer restricted payment methods, which can hinder deposits and withdrawals.
- Regulatory Concerns: Ensure that the casino is licensed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), as playing on unregulated sites can pose risks to your funds.
